A member asked:

I have been on my period for two weeks and last week and this week when i coughed it felt like i had wet myself but instead a gush of blood and clots?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

See gynecologist: When you are menstruating, it is normal to sometimes have a "gush" of blood from the vagina when you cough (increase intra-abdominal pressure) or stand. This blood has pooled in the vagina and is simply coming out. However, if your period is persisting for longer than normal I would advise you to make an appointment with your gynecologist for an evaluation.
